基于OpenStack的云计算数据中心管理系统的设计与开发 - 图文

2019-03-27 19:47

南京邮电大学 毕 业 设 计(论 文)

题 目

专 业 学生姓名 班级学号 指导教师 指导单位

日期:

基于OpenStack的云计算数据中心管理系统

网络工程

物联网学院

年 1月 19日至 2015年 6月 12日

2015

毕业设计(论文)原创性声明

本人郑重声明:所提交的毕业设计(论文),是本人在导师指导下,独立进行研究工作所取得的成果。除文中已注明引用的内容外,本毕业设计(论文)不包含任何其他个人或集体已经发表或撰写过的作品成果。对本研究做出过重要贡献的个人和集体,均已在文中以明确方式标明并表示了谢意。

论文作者签名:

日期: 年 月 日

摘 要

云计算(Cloud Computing)是网格计算(Grid Computing)、分布式计算(Distributed Computing)、并行计算(Parallel Computing)、效用计算(Utility Computing)、联机存储技术(Network Storage Technology)、虚拟化(Virtualization)、负载均衡(Load Balance)等一系列传统计算机技术和网络技术发展融合的产物。它旨在通过网络将多个成本低廉的计算实体整合成一个大型计算资源池,并借助SaaS、PaaS、IaaS等服务模式,将强大的计算能力分发到终端用户手中。云计算的核心理念就是通过不断提高“云”端处理能力,减轻用户负担,将一系列的IT能力以服务形式提供给用户,简化用户终端的处理负担,最终使用户成为一个单纯的输入/输出设备,享受“云”提供的强大计算处理及服务能力。

OpenStack是一个开源的云计算项目和工具集,并且提供了关于基础设施即服务(IaaS)的解决方案。OpenStack具有建设这样资源池的能力,通过OpenStack的各种组件多种模式的排列组合,可以搭建成各种规模的“云”,这些云可以是私有云、公有云、混合云。本文首先介绍了云计算的背景及其相关技术,并深入了解OpenStack的架构和其各种服务,掌握各种服务实现原理,以及探讨OpenStack如何实现对云计算数据中心的管理,最后动手搭建OpenStack云平台和尝试对功能的扩展。由于OpenStack云计算平台在国内的研究起步较晚,在安装部署过程中会出现若干问题。本文就出现的问题加以汇总并给出解决方法,可以在安装部署OpenStack时提供参考。

关键词:云计算;IaaS;OpenStack;管理平台

ABSTRACT

Cloud Computing is the product of a series of traditional computer technology and network technology integration of Grid Computing, Distributed Computing, Parallel Computing, Utility Computing, Network Storage Technology, Virtualization, Load Balance and so on. It is designed by the network to integrate multiple low-cost computing entity into a large pool of computing resources, and with SaaS, PaaS, IaaS services model, the computing power is distributed to the end users. Cloud computing is the core concept by continuously improving the \reduce the burden on the user, a series of IT capabilities as a service to users, simplify the processing burden on the user terminal, and ultimately make the user a simple input / output equipment. What's more, people could enjoy powerful computing capabilities \

OpenStack is an open source cloud computing projects and tools, and provides information on the infrastructure as a service (IaaS) solutions. OpenStack has the ability to build such a resource pool, through permutations and combinations of the various components of OpenStack multiple modes, can be built into a variety of sizes, \describes the background of cloud computing and related technologies, and in-depth understanding of OpenStack architecture and its various services. In order to acknowlodge a variety of services to achieve the principles, and to explore how to achieve the OpenStack cloud computing data center management, we finally have come up with OpenStack Cloud platform and try to extend the capabilities. Since the OpenStack cloud computing platform in China started late, there will be a number of issues in the installation and deployment process. This article appeared to be summary of the issues and gives solutions that can provide a reference during the installation deploy OpenStack.

Keywords: Cloud Computing; IaasS; OpenStack; Management Platform

目 录

第一章 绪论 ........................................... 1

1.1 研究背景及意义 .............................................. 1

1.1.1 背景及意义............................................. 1 1.1.2 国内外发展现状......................................... 1 1.2 研究工作意义 ................................................ 3 1.3 论文组织结构 ................................................ 4

第二章 IaaS及关键技术相关介绍 ......................... 5

2.1 Iaas概述.................................................... 5 2.2 IaaS服务特征及优势.......................................... 5 2.3 IaaS整体架构................................................ 5 2.4 IaaS关键技术介绍............................................ 7

2.4.1 虚拟化技术............................................. 7 2.4.2 KVM与QEMU............................................. 7 2.4.3 数据存储技术........................................... 8 2.4.4 资源管理技术........................................... 9 2.4.5 能耗管理技术........................................... 9 2.5 本章小结 ................................................... 10

第三章 OpenStack相关介绍 ............................. 11

3.1 OpenStack简介.............................................. 11

3.1.1 OpenStack基础架构 .................................... 11 3.1.2 OpenStack访问流程 .................................... 12 3.2 OpenStack认证服务——Keystone.............................. 13

3.2.1 Keystone介绍 ......................................... 13 3.2.2 Keystone概念 ......................................... 13 3.3 OpenStack计算服务——Nova.................................. 14

3.3.1 Nova简介 ............................................. 14 3.3.2 Nova架构 ............................................. 15 3.3.3 Nova工作流程 ......................................... 16 3.4 OpenStack网络服务——Neutron............................... 17

3.4.1 Neutron介绍 .......................................... 17 3.4.2 Neutron 网络创建过程.................................. 18 3.5 本章小结 ................................................... 19

第四章 OpenStack云管理平台的搭建 ..................... 20

4.1 单节点安装部署OpenStack.................................... 20

4.1.1 实验环境及实验拓扑.................................... 20


基于OpenStack的云计算数据中心管理系统的设计与开发 - 图文.do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:福州市凤坂河综合治理工程施工组织设计

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: